A Study to Evaluate the enVista® Aspire (EA) Intraocular Lens in Subjects Undergoing Cataract Extraction

A Non-interventional, Prospective, Multicenter, Single Arm, Post-Marketing Clinical Study to Evaluate the enVista® Aspire (EA) Intraocular Lens in Subjects Undergoing Cataract Extraction.
Bausch & Lomb IncorporatedClinicalTrials.govdeviceDevice trial
